ComenzarEmpieza gratis

ANY_VALUE

Una de las funciones nuevas que has aprendido y que es específica de GoogleSQL es el agregado ANY_VALUE, que te permite devolver un valor de una columna de texto. Puedes usarla junto con HAVING para encontrar un valor máximo o mínimo. Esto nos da flexibilidad para devolver un único valor al agregar sobre un conjunto de datos grande.

Este ejercicio forma parte del curso

Introducción a BigQuery

Ver curso

Instrucciones del ejercicio

  • Completa la consulta usando la función de agregado ANY_VALUE en la columna product_category_name_english, incluyendo la cláusula HAVING para encontrar el valor máximo de product_photos_qty, y asigna el alias random_product al resultado.

Ejercicio interactivo práctico

Prueba este ejercicio y completa el código de muestra.

-- Finish the query below by adding the ANY_VALUE function

SELECT
  product_weight_g,
    -- Complete the query by adding the ANY_VALUE function on the product category column
	___
FROM ecommerce.ecomm_products
GROUP BY product_weight_g;
Editar y ejecutar código